碘化镍水合物 制备方法及用途

制备方法

将NiI2水溶液蒸发至成浆状,滤出其中的六水合物晶体,抽干。或先用制备无水NiI2相同的方法制取,但免去在140℃干燥这一步。

碘化镍水合物 物化性质

稳定性相关:

在空气中迅速潮解变成褐色并游离出碘。加热至43℃时,尚可存在,但在水浴上加热即变成无水物。

其它信息:

性状:蓝绿色结晶。
